SUMMARY OF POSITION :
Care for ill, injured, or convalescing patients or persons with disabilities in hospitals, nursing homes, clinics, private homes, group homes, and similar institutions. May work under the supervision of a registered nurse.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ATION(S):
High School Diploma or equivalent required.
Graduate of an approved Licensed Practical Nursing School with current licensure to practice in Pennsylvania or licensure eligibility required.
One (1) year of LPN experience required.
BLS Certification required.
